Levacetylleucine
Synonym(s): N-Acetyl-L-leucine
- CAS No.: 1188-21-2
- Formula:C8H15NO3
- Molecular Weight:173.21
IUPAC Name: acetyl-L-leucine
InChIKey: WXNXCEHXYPACJF-ZETCQYMHSA-N
SMILES: CC(C)C[C@H](NC(C)=O)C(O)=O
Biological Activity: Levacetylleucine (N-acetyl-L-leucine), an orally bioavailable and brain-penetrant compound, is an acetylated derivative of amino acid Leucine. Levacetylleucine is the active form of N-acetyl-leucine (NAL). Levacetylleucine attenuates neuronal death and neuroinflammation in the cortical tissue of mice. Levacetylleucine also potentially improves ameliorates lysosomal and metabolic dysfunction. Levacetylleucine improves compensation of postural symptoms after unilateral chemical labyrinthectomy (UL) in rats. Levacetylleucine is promising for research of neurological manifestations of Niemann-Pick disease type C, traumatic brain injury and neurodegeneration prevention[1][2][3][4].
